Measurement of the π⁰ electromagnetic transition form factor Drees, Reena Meijer
Abstract
We present the result of a measurement of the π⁰ electromagnetic transition form factor in the time-like region of momentum transfer. From a data sample of roughly 100,000 π⁰ → e⁺ e⁻ γ decays, observed in the SINDRUM I magnetic spectrometer at the Paul Scherrer Institute (Switzerland), we measure a value of the form factor slope a = 0.02 ± 0.01 (stat) ± 0.02 (sys). This measurement is consistent with both the results of the recent measurement by CELLO (DESY) in the space-like region, and with the vector meson dominance prediction of a ≈ 0.03.
